The 20th Medical Group (20 MDG) provides ambulatory medical and dental services to the 20th Fighter Wing, Headquarters 9th Air Force, USAFCENT, USARCENT, Shaw associate units and thousands of military retirees in the area. The Shaw clinic is accredited by the Accreditation Association for Ambulatory Health Care (AAAHC).
 
The 20 MDG provides primary care services with aerospace medicine, limited specialty care and ancillary (pharmacy, laboratory, radiology) capabilities. We do not provide inpatient or emergency services but ambulance services are available to on base personnel at all times by calling 911.
 
Outpatient care is provided for pediatric through geriatric patients. Shaw clinic's range of services include pediatrics, family health, flight medicine, limited gynecological services, oral surgery, general dentistry, periodontics, prosthodontics, physical therapy, optometry, mental health, family advocacy, laboratory, pharmacy, public health, radiology, health & wellness, and immunizations.

All care not performed at Shaw AFB is arranged through referrals to a robust network of military hospitals and TRICARE civilian medical resources in the surrounding communities. We are fortunate to be surrounded with extremely high caliber medical services and most specialties within a reasonable distance of the base.

Pharmacy

The Pharmacy dispenses medications upon receipt of a written prescription from a military or civilian provider. The Pharmacy must follow South Carolina State law with regard to pharmacy practice. If you receive your care from a civilian provider, please come by the Pharmacy and pick up a list of medications stocked at the 20th Medical Group Pharmacy.


Shaw AFB Pharmacies will not be able to fill a prescription for a medication not on our formulary. New prescriptions from 20 MDG providers and from civilian providers are filled at the main pharmacy. All patients must pull a ticket from the ticket station located in the pharmacy lobby for their prescription to be processed. Your ticket number will be called to the first free pharmacy window in the order it was pulled from the machine. Prescription refills are called into and filled at the Satellite/BX Pharmacy only (located in the Base Exchange complex).

Pharmacy hours of operation are:

Main Pharmacy Hours Satellite/BX Pharmacy Hours
Monday-Friday: 0800 - 1700 hrs Monday-Friday: 0900 - 1700 hrs

Shaw Pharmacies are closed on Sat/Sun/Holidays/Wing Down Days and the First Friday of every other month for training (Feb, Apr, June, Aug, Oct, Dec).

The Satellite/BX Pharmacy has a convenient call-in refill service. Refills called in before 1200 are ready the next duty day. Refills called in after 1200 are ready within two duty days. The phone numbers for this system are 895-6678 or toll free at 1-877-796-2273. The Pharmacy cannot refill prescriptions originally filled at a civilian pharmacy.

You must present your Identification Card (ID) to the Pharmacy window when dropping off a prescription or picking up medication. Pharmacy staff members will dispense medications when presented with a valid ID card.

Patients may also elect to have their prescriptions filled at either the TRICARE Mail Order Pharmacy (TMOP) or a local civilian pharmacy that accepts TRICARE. Unless you are active duty, there will be a co-pay for each prescription filled at these locations. There is no co-pay for active duty members. Keep in mind those medications that are non-formulary at Shaw AFB may be formulary medications at these two pharmacies, and may therefore be available at the lower co-pays.

In order to utilize the TMOP, patients need to register with TMOP. Registration forms can be obtained either Shaw Pharmacy. They can also be obtained by contacting the TMOP at the following toll-free number: 866-363-8667.
Additional questions about the TMOP can be answered by your pharmacy staff at Shaw, the toll-free number provided above, or through the following website: www.express-scripts.com.

Non-Controlled Medication Turn-In at Shaw Pharmacy
As a customer courtesy, both the Shaw Main and BX Pharmacies accept non-controlled medication for turn-in/disposal of prescription or over-the-counter medications. Shaw pharmacies do not accept turn in of controlled substances (medication you had to sign for). Please contact Shaw Main Pharmacy at 803-895-6678 if you have any questions.
